#eefec4 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#eefec4 is composed of 93.3% red, 99.6% green and 76.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 6.3% cyan, 0% magenta, 22.8% yellow and 0.4% black. It has a hue angle of 76.6 degrees, a saturation of 96.7% and a lightness of 88.2%. #eefec4 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#ddfd89. Closest websafe color is: #ffffcc.

#eefec4 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#eefec4 has RGB values of R:238, G:254, B:196 and CMYK values of C:0.06, M:0, Y:0.23, K:0. Its decimal value is 15662788.
